Whole-House Generators Kick In Automatically

Another important benefit to keep in mind about whole-house generators is that you’ll never need to do anything to make sure it’ll start working properly. Even if your power goes out right as you leave for work, your whole-house generator will begin working and will retain your home’s full functionality all day long.

Our team fully understands how important this type of extended security is for everyone when it comes to keeping food storage like your fridge/freezer at an optimal temperature during extended outages, and maintaining overall household temperature is another big factor that you don’t have to worry about with these high-quality generators!

Whole-House Generators Are Connected To Your Home’s Electrical Panel

The fact that your whole-house generator will be fully connected to your household’s electrical panel is a very important benefit that homeowners should always keep in mind.

What this means is that you’ll never have to go outside during bad weather and hook anything up to make sure that your generator will properly start working. With a whole-house generator, you can relax knowing that your home’s electrical system is being controlled by state-of-the-art technology and that nothing is required from you!

They’re Very Cost-Effective

You of course have a lot more than just your comfort to worry about when your power goes out, and one of the main concerns that homeowners have in this type of situation is how they’re going to maintain the integrity of their food supply in their freezer and fridge. Meats and other foods stored in freezers can go bad pretty quickly during extended power outages, and this loss of food can always be costly for families when they have to replace supplies that they’ve been stocking up for months if not years.

There are also many instances in which people store their important medications in their freezer or fridge, and power outages can put these types of medications at risk. This means that lacking a powerful, whole-house generator can potentially put you at a health risk if your medication is something that you need on a daily basis. These types of medications are also many times really expensive, so you shouldn’t need to worry about these types of concerns given the fact that your power could potentially go out at any moment.

Another factor that families tend to like when it comes to the cost-effectiveness of whole-house generators is that they go a long way in ensuring the comfort of kids and helping them remain entertained. We’ve heard of countless scenarios in which families spend money on hotel rooms so they can get out of the blazing summer heat during an extended power outage, or that they continuously spend extra money on entertainment/restaurants just to make sure their kids stay entertained when their power is out.

So there truly are countless ways in which a whole-house generator installation can end up paying for itself in the long run!
